Advance Practice Provider (Nurse Practitioner or Physician Assistant) provides emergency medicine services to patients. Such care includes evaluation, diagnosis, treatment, and documentation. Coordinates ancillary, and other services to achieve the best and most cost-effective outcomes for patients under his/her care. Work schedule: Shifts are variable in length depending on location and a 1.0 FTE is defined as 1,440 hours per contract year or 120 hours per month. Work location : APPs will rotate between Madras, Prineville, and Redmond campuses.
